ACCIDENTS AND FATALITIES.

‘ Press Association. Napier, April 12. A stock train ran into a number of horses on the railway line between Napier and Point Ahuriri at about 11 o’clock on Saturday night, killing four of them and injuring one. The horses belong to Maoris who are working at a clearing and road formation on the Whare-a-Maraenui reclaimed land. A gun accident occurred on Watchman Island, inner harbour, at about five o’clock this afternoon, resulting in the instantaneous death of Fred Oulton, aged about 26, a coach painter. He was 4 one of a party who were shooting stags, and while he was descending a steep rocky side of the island with the aid of a wire rope fixed there, his gun went off. The upper part of his head was blown away. Auckland,A pril 13. A boy aged four, named Henry Outhbertson, residing at Lincoln street, Ponsonby fell from the verandah railing to the asphalt path seven feet below, and sustained injuries from which he died on Sunday.
